Rekindle Your Passion During Quarantine

Everyone is passionate about something. Whether that passion is a hobby, personal development, faith, work or any other assortment of items. It seems as we go through life and accrue more aspects of responsibility (career, family growth, medical issues, debt, the busyness of life, a traumatic event, etc.) we often either:

  1. Lose focus of where your passion lays

  2. Don't prioritize it because other things seem more important

"How Do I Know If I Have Lost Focus Of My Passions?"


Do you feel like what you do only serves other people?

Are you able to spend time alone (including whether you have a spouse/kids/or both)?

When was the last time you did something for yourself and enjoyed personal time?


If you have difficulty answering any of these OR you honestly cannot, allow yourself a chance to become better both for yourself and for others.


Serving others is amazing, but there are times where personal time, your own enjoyment, reflection, scribing, meditation and more need to take priority.


Making time for yourself is one of the most important times of the day/week to not only grow as a person, but it gives you time to think about things going on in your life. Time which allows you to ask questions similar to "How can I better my life?" and "Which areas of my life can benefit from growth?".


Taking time for yourself whether in the morning/evening, a workout, walking your pup, cooking, etc. not only helps clear your mind but helps you think within.

 

How Can I Find What I'm Passionate About?


One of the easiest ways is to think about what you most enjoy about the now, but what did you enjoy in the past? Do you wish you still had time to do some of those things you don't do anymore?


If you wish you still had time for things you don't do anymore, MAKE TIME. Life is about enjoyment and you're only given so much time on this planet. If you enjoy doing something, go after it, make time for it. If you want others involved, invite them. Tell them why you enjoy it, maybe they'll find passion in it as well.
